### Step 4 — Upgrade the Quillbus broker

Before upgrading Quillbus from 6.2 to 7.0, drain all consumers on the Marrowfield cluster and confirm queue depth reads zero on the Ledgerline dashboard. The 7.0 packages use a new repository channel, so the old trust chain no longer applies; upgrades will fail signature checks until the new chain is installed. Support staff walking customers through this should paste the instructions verbatim. Add the new repository, then import the package-signing key shown below.

rollout seal: bky3_bf1

Ticket: Missed pick-up — antique clock repair. Hey dispatch, the mantel clock that was supposed to go to Farrow & Tine Clockworks never got collected yesterday. Customer (Mrs. Alderlea) is understandably twitchy — the thing is apparently a family heirloom from her grandmother. It's boxed, padded, and sitting behind the counter at our Millpond Road shop. Can we get someone out tomorrow morning? Please flag it as fragile and priority. When the courier arrives, they must follow this instruction:

handover note for yagef-bagep: the drudor pelius courier leaves the kasdor zorvan norir ledger at gate 8016 under passcode 755406

## Autoscaler Approval Process

Changes to the Driftgate queue-depth autoscaler (scaling thresholds, cooldown windows, or the depth-sampling interval) require a two-stage approval before any release train can include them. The release manager must confirm that load-simulation results are attached and that the rollback plan names a specific config revision. No exceptions apply during freeze periods. Final authority for approving autoscaler changes rests with the individual named below.

named custodian: Brivan Eliath Quenox Frador